The Complete Guide to Vascular Ultrasound
Book info: The Complete Guide to Vascular Ultrasound (Paperback, 176 pages – LWW, 2004) – LWW, 2004. Language: Eng.
This essential resource serves as a thorough guide for ultrasound practitioners focusing on vascular pathology. Readers will gain a solid foundation in both the technical aspects and the analytical skills necessary for effective vascular ultrasound evaluation. The book meticulously covers critical areas such as abdominal vessels, peripheral arteries, hemodialysis access, bypass grafts, peripheral veins, penile circulation, and the cerebrovascular system. Each chapter is structured to enhance understanding, featuring sections on anatomy, relevant pathologies, patient questioning strategies, examination methods, and diagnostic interpretations. Additionally, over 100 vibrant Doppler images enrich the learning experience by vividly illustrating a wide range of pathological conditions.
